Lane's Arabic-English Lexicon

أَحْوَذَ

Root: حوذ

Form: 4

Full Definition

أَحْوَذَIV , Verbal.Noun إِحْوَاذٌ: see 1, in four places.
1 احوذ ثَوْبَهُ He gathered together his garment, and drew it to him.
2 احوذ القِدْحَ [in some copies of the K القَدَحَ He (a workman, صَانِع [in some copies of the K صَائغ]) made the arrow light, by scraping or paring it: a phrase used by Lebeed, in describing the arrow termed المَنِيح.
